Full recovery after ACL Reconstruction Surgery

Clinical History:

11 years old Owen is a keen sports player and loves playing football, skiing and racing. He has won many championships also. He was hit from behind on his left knee while playing football and injured himself.

MRI scan confirmed a complete rupture of the anterior cruciate ligament (ACL).

Owen underwent an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) surgery in December 2020.

Professor Adrian Wilson is delighted to say that he has made an excellent recovery post his ACL surgery and now has full movement and full stability and is really looking forward to getting back to his football, which will start very slowly.
